Output 998bc22cddccbd52e4c67abdb07bbac796b43dcf0f5a2ae8989ea8e8c8b61527:3

value
466962529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a653c1ae40c47ec114d6d58cf6313a0a79918f OP_EQUAL
address
39mke3F64ExcpkWanyLkojUwtYfvfCgZzd
transaction
998bc22cddccbd52e4c67abdb07bbac796b43dcf0f5a2ae8989ea8e8c8b61527
confirmations
148234
spent
true